Steering System - General Information -
Power Steering System Bleeding
S-MAX/Galaxy 2006.5 (02/2006-)
General Procedures
Special Tool(s)
Materials
211-189
Adapter, Power Steering Bleeding
416-D001
Hand Vacuum Pump/Pressure Pump
Name
Specification
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S WSS-M2C204-A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A
1. Fill the power steering fluid reservoir to the MAX
mark.
Material:
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S (WSS-M2C204-
A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A)
2. Raise the vehicle until the road wheels are clear
of the floor. Support the vehicle.
Refer to:
Lifting
(100-02 Jacking and Lifting,
Description and Operation).
3. Start the engine and slowly turn the steering
wheel from lock to lock and add power steering
fluid until the power steering fluid in the power
steering fluid reservoir does not drop.
4. Switch OFF the engine and examine the power
steering hose connections, steering gear boots,
power steering valve body and power steering
pump for external leaks.
5. Check the power steering fluid level. Fill the
power steering fluid reservoir to the MAX mark.
Material:
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S (WSS-M2C204-
A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A)
6. When bleeding the power steering system the
vacuum will decrease. Using the special tools,
maintain a sufficient vacuum of 38cm-Hg. If the
vacuum decreases by more than 5cm-Hg in 5
minutes, the system should be checked for leaks.
Special Tool(s):
211-189
,
416-D001
7.
1. Start the engine and slowly turn the
steering wheel from lock to lock once; then
turn the steering wheel to the right, just
off the stop.
2. Switch OFF the engine.
3. Using the special tools, create a vacuum of
38cm-Hg. Maintain the vacuum until the
air is evacuated from the system
(minimum of five minutes).
Special Tool(s):
211-189
,
416-D001
4. Release the vacuum.
5. Repeat the power steering bleeding
procedure, turning the steering wheel to
the left, just off the stop.
6. Remove the special tools. Fill the power
steering fluid reservoir to the MAX as
necessary.
Material:
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S (WSS-
M2C204-A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A)
8. Start the engine, turn the steering wheel from
lock to lock. If excessive noise is apparent,
repeat the power steering bleeding procedure.
9. Lower the vehicle.
10. If the noise level is still unacceptable, leave the
vehicle standing overnight then repeat the power
steering system bleeding procedure.
Steering System - General Information -
Power Steering System Flushing
S-MAX/Galaxy 2006.5 (02/2006-)
General Procedures
Materials
Name
Specification
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S WSS-M2C204-A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A
1.
WARNING: Be prepared to collect
escaping fluids.
Using a blanking cap, cap the power steering
fluid reservoir.
2. Place the end of the steering gear return line into
a container.
3. Fill the power steering reservoir to the MAX
mark.
Material:
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S (WSS-M2C204-
A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A)
4. Raise the vehicle until the road wheels are clear
of the floor. Support the vehicle.
Refer to:
Lifting
(100-02 Jacking and Lifting,
Description and Operation).
5.
NOTE: This step requires the aid of another
technician.
1. Start the engine and slowly turn the
steering from steering lock to steering lock
until clean power steering fluid comes out
of the return line.
2. With the aid of another technician, add the
power steering fluid until the system is free
of contaminated power steering fluid.
Material:
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S (WSS-
M2C204-A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A)
Steering System - General Information -
Power Steering System Filling
S-MAX/Galaxy 2006.5 (02/2006-)
General Procedures
Special Tool(s)
Materials
211-189
Adapter, Power Steering Bleeding
416-D001
Hand Vacuum Pump/Pressure Pump
Name
Specification
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S WSS-M2C204-A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A
1. Fill the power steering fluid reservoir to the MAX
mark.
Material:
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S (WSS-M2C204-
A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A)
2. Raise the vehicle until the road wheels are clear
of the floor. Support the vehicle.
Refer to:
Lifting
(100-02 Jacking and Lifting,
Description and Operation).
3. Slowly turn the steering wheel from lock to lock
and add power steering fluid until the power
steering fluid in the power steering fluid reservoir
stops dropping.
4. Start the engine and slowly turn the steering
wheel from lock to lock and add power steering
fluid until the power steering fluid in the power
steering fluid reservoir stops dropping.
5. Switch the engine OFF and using the special
tools, create a vacuum of 62cm-Hg - 75cm-Hg
for 30 seconds.
Special Tool(s):
211-189
,
416-D001
6.
1. Observe the vacuum gauge reading.
2. If the vacuum decreases by more than
5cm-Hg in 5 minutes, the system should
be checked for leaks.
7. Remove the special tools. Fill the power steering
fluid reservoir to the MAX mark as necessary.
Material:
Hydraulic Fluid DP-PS (WSS-M2C204-
A2 / 5U7J-M2C204-AA)
